Discover the flavors and culture of Tsukiji on a private walking tour with a local guide.
Over two hours, explore Tsukiji’s lively market streets, hidden corners, and everyday food culture while learning the stories behind this famous area. Along the way, enjoy three local street foods included in the tour, carefully selected by your guide. You will also visit both a Shinto shrine and a Buddhist temple, offering a deeper look into Japan’s spiritual traditions.
Perfect for travelers who want more than just a food tour, this experience combines local flavors, cultural insight, and the flexibility of a private guide.

Tsukiji Fish Market
Explore lively stalls filled with fresh seafood, produce, and traditional ingredients. Learn about the market’s history and why it remains central to Japanese cuisine!
Namiyoke Inari Shrine
A historic shrine that has protected Tsukiji since the Edo period, known for its powerful lion heads. Watch how locals pray for safety and good fortune, and experience a core part of Japanese culture!
